Massage and Energy Work are beneficial for anyone going through cancer treatments: surgery, chemotherapy, radiation. The sessions are helpful before and after treatments.
A study conducted at Memorial Sloan-Kettering Cancer Center showed that patients who received massage therapy experienced reduced levels of anxiety, pain, fatigue, depression and nausea even two days later.
